☐ Secure interview room (Room 4, Aldgrove Wing): confirm the booking sheet is current and the white-noise unit by the door is switched on before the new starter's induction interviews begin. Facilities should sweep the room each morning for left-behind notes. The door lock resets overnight, so re-arm it at opening using the code below.

door code, yagap-bahof: bdg-O-05

Internal Memo — Loyalty Programme Overhaul

For the incoming director of Fernhollow Markets: the Orchard Points overhaul replaces tiered earning with flat accrual plus seasonal multipliers. Migration of legacy balances completes next month; breakage assumptions were revised downward after audit review. Please study the phasing schedule carefully. The confidential note below outlines the associated business plans.

management briefing: Project Ulavan slips by two quarters because of the staffing delay.

**Vendor note: Inkmill markdown pipeline**

Rendering for Parchway docs is outsourced to Inkmill under an annual contract, renewing each March. They handle sanitization and PDF export; we own the upload queue. SLA: 4-hour response on rendering failures. Escalate only after two failed retries. Their support desk is reachable at the address below.

billing contact of hahaf-baguf = zorael.tammir.jorius@sivrelhq.internal